Trial ID:
RBR-3kcsy25
Public Title:
8-week Mindfulness Based Taining for parents of children with Autism and impact assesment on indices of Anxiety, Stress, Depression, Life Satisfaction, and Mindfulness
Scientific Title:
8-week Mindfulness Based Taining for parents of children with Autism Spectrum Disorder and impact assesment on indices of Anxiety, Stress, Depression, Life Satisfaction, and Mindfulness

Inclusion Criteria:
Be parents of children between 5 months and 14 years of age who have a diagnosis of autism spectrum disorder established according to the DSM-V criteria. Accept and be available to participate in one of the 2 mindfulness intervention groups for 8 weeks (8 meetings of approximately 2 hours) to be held online via the Zoom platform. Agree to complete the pre- and post-intervention questionnaires, as well as the Informed Consent Form (TCLE - Termo de Consentimento Livre e Esclarecido) and a health screening questionnaire.
Exclusion Criteria:
Patients who are unable to attend online sessions at the scheduled times, either due to lack of availability or adequate equipment (computer with webcam, headphones, microphone, and broadband internet). Patients with more than 2 absences from the program or who miss the first or second session of the program. Participants with a diagnosis of a serious illness such as cancer, epilepsy. Participants with a diagnosis of an uncontrolled psychiatric disorder: schizophrenia, bipolar disorder, severe depression.
